German Shepherd Rescue is a no-kill shelter dedicated to saving and finding homes for purebred German Shepherd Dogs.
We are a non-profit 501(c)(3) organization run by volunteers and funded entirely by donations and adoption fees.

Additional adoption info
The first step in the adoption process is to fill out our application, which does NOT obligate you to adopt. It is to provide us with information about your situation and what you are looking for in a dog so that we can help you further. You can find our online application at our web site on the "About Us" page.
Once you submit your application, one of our adoption coordinators will contact you to review your application. A home visit will then be scheduled to help you to ensure that the environment is safe for a large-breed dog.
A minimum donation of $250 will be asked when an adoption is approved.
Please do not submit an application if you do not live in Southern California or are not serious about adopting a German Shepherd Dog.
